About the role
We are seeking a Senior Vehicle Integration Engineer to own vehicle bring-up and sensor calibration across our autonomous platforms. In this role, you will take a vehicle from mechanically complete, to first autonomous engagement, to a validated unit released into the fleet, owning the sequence, the calibration method, and the acceptance criteria that determine when a vehicle is ready. You will build the calibration and test infrastructure that turns bring-up from an engineering activity into a repeatable process the production team can run without you.
What you’ll do
- Vehicle Bring-Up: Own the bring-up sequence end to end: power-on, firmware and software load, device enumeration, systems validation, first autonomous engagement validation and the sign-off that releases a vehicle to the fleet.
- Sensor Calibration: Own intrinsic and extrinsic calibration across the full sensor suite of lidar, radar, camera, IMU, and GNSS. Build and maintain the physical calibration environment, define what "in calibration" means, how it is verified, and how a drifting or incorrect calibration is caught early.
- Test Plans & Validation: Author the test plans and procedures our fleet is validated against, execute them, analyze the resulting data, and report results clearly enough to act on.
- Cross-Domain Diagnosis: Resolve ambiguous failures across the mechanical, electrical, firmware, and software boundary, and hand the owning engineer reproduction steps and evidence rather than a symptom.
- Test Hardware & Tooling: Specify, build, and maintain the benches, harness breakouts, and diagnostic tooling the process depends on, building what does not yet exist.
- Design Feedback: Feed what you learn back into hardware design (e.g. sensor mounting and tolerance stack-ups that make calibration difficult).
- Technician Partnership: Partner with our engineering technicians as customers, who will execute the builds and bring-up.
What we’re looking for
- Bachelor's or Master's deg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, Mechatronics, Mechanical Engineering, or a related field is required, or equivalent hands-on experience.
- 3+ years integrating, validating, and debugging electrical and electromechanical systems on prototype and production vehicles in autonomous vehicles, EVs, or at an automotive OEM or supplier, with a proven track record of technical ownership.
- Deep hands-on expertise in vehicle E/E architecture: low-voltage power distribution and redundancy, wire harness and connector systems for both low and high voltage, and the failure modes that come with them.
- Fluency with automotive networks and diagnostics (CAN, CAN FD, Automotive Ethernet, and DTCs) and the supporting tooling, including Vector CANalyzer, Vehicle Spy, oscilloscopes, and logic analyzers.
- Experience integrating and debugging vehicle actuation interfaces: steering, braking, and propulsion, or comparable motor-control and powertrain systems, including redundant, degraded, and fail-operational behavior.
- Experience integrating compute into vehicles: carrier boards, high-speed differential signaling, power sequencing, and thermal management.
- Proven ability to navigate highly ambiguous environments, self-direct technical problem-solving, and clearly communicate technical trade-offs to cross-functional partners.
- Ability to work onsite five days a week in San Francisco, travel to test and deployment sites, and hold a valid driver's license with a clean driving record.
